God’s Word for Today - 03 Nov 2025
Zechariah 7:10 (KJV): And oppress not the widow, nor the fatherless, the stranger, nor the poor; and let none of you imagine evil against his brother in your heart.
Reflection on God’s Word for Today - 03 Nov 2025
People who proclaim Jesus Christ as their Saviour and Lord are said to be in the world but not of the world. They are set apart unto Jehovah and committed to living to please God and to bring Him glory. They are not supposed to emulate any of the behaviours that are rampant in the world. Sadly, one is unable to distinguish the difference between those who are in the world and those who are in churches where they claim to be following Christ. The injustice against the defenceless poor and immigrant populations in many churches across the world is undeniable and this is contrary to what God expects of His people. If you have been guilty of inflicting pain on the defenceless or keeping silent in the face of injustice, then you must repent and seek forgiveness from Jehovah now. Come clean with God and end your hypocrisy today.
